How the Globe2See Travel Planning Assistant Works

The Human-supported Travel Planning Assistant is for travellers who want more support than the Self-service Travel Budgeting Tool provides. You describe your trip idea, the Digital Assistant helps clarify the request, and a human planning specialist prepares the plan according to the agreed scope.

Globe2See is a travel planning and travel budgeting environment, not a booking site. Globe2See does not make bookings for you. The Travel Assistant helps you prepare before you buy; you still check final prices, availability, conditions, and make bookings directly with the relevant service providers.

How the process works

  1. Start a request. Use Request Travel Assistant and describe your trip idea, destination wishes, timing, group, budget, travel style, and any special needs.
  2. The Digital Assistant helps clarify the request. You may be asked questions so your request becomes easier for the planning team to understand. You can use freeform writing and voice where available.
  3. Add useful context. You can add messages and files when they help explain your plans, constraints, preferences, or existing bookings.
  4. Review the request summary. Before the request moves forward, check that the summary reflects what you actually want.
  5. Globe2See reviews the request. A human planning specialist or admin reviews the request and decides whether it is suitable for Travel Assistant work.
  6. Receive a quote when paid planning work is needed. The quote covers the planning service and agreed scope. It does not include flights, hotels, activities, restaurants, local transport, or other provider costs.
  7. Accept the quote and pay through Stripe. If you accept the quote, payment is handled securely by Stripe. Globe2See does not collect or see your payment card details.
  8. A human planning specialist prepares the plan. The specialist works on your request, may ask clarifying questions, and prepares the agreed planning material.
  9. Receive the delivered plan. The delivered plan may include messages, recommendations, links, files, and plan versions depending on the agreed scope.
  10. Check and book directly with providers. Use the plan as planning support. Before buying or reserving anything, verify current prices, availability, times, rules, and provider conditions yourself.

What the delivered plan may include

The exact content depends on the request and the agreed quote. A Travel Assistant plan may include a route idea, destination notes, transport suggestions, accommodation areas or examples, activity ideas, food or local information, useful links, documents, or other supporting material.

Some information may be based on available provider data, public sources, or planning estimates. Travel conditions and provider prices can change, so the delivered plan should always be checked before booking.

Payments and Globe2See invoices

Travel Assistant payments are connected to the accepted quote or payment step for the human-supported request. Payments are handled through Stripe, and Globe2See issues its own invoice after confirmed payment.

The planning-service quote is separate from your actual trip costs. Flights, hotels, restaurants, activities, tickets, local transport, insurance, visas, and other travel services are booked and paid by you directly with providers.
